Nursing homes in Glendora, California, provide essential care for people who may need assistance with daily activities due to aging, illness, or disability. Consideration for nursing homes is relevant for seniors or those facing health challenges that impact their ability to live independently. If someone is finding it challenging to manage daily tasks like bathing, dressing, or medication management, or if their safety at home is a concern, nursing homes in Glendora could be a suitable option.

Deciding when it's time to move to a nursing home often involves assessing one's physical and mental health needs. If an individual's health conditions have progressed to a point where constant supervision and specialized care are required, a nursing home becomes a prudent choice. Additionally, social isolation or the inability to meet basic needs independently can be indicators. Engaging in open communication with healthcare professionals, family members, and the individual themselves can help in determining when the move to a nursing home in Glendora is the right decision.

The process of moving to a nursing home involves several steps. First, it's crucial to research and visit different facilities in Glendora to find the one that best meets the individual's needs. Once a suitable nursing home is identified, the transition may involve coordinating with healthcare providers to ensure a smooth transfer of medical records and medications. Families can also work with the nursing home staff to understand the daily routines, activities, and any necessary preparations for the move. Open communication and support during this transition can help ease the adjustment for the individual moving to the nursing home.

Families seeking financial assistance for nursing homes in Glendora can explore various options. Medicaid is a government program that provides support for low-income individuals, and it may cover nursing home costs. Additionally, long-term care insurance and veterans' benefits are potential avenues for financial aid. Families are advised to consult with financial advisors or professionals specializing in eldercare to explore available resources and ensure a comprehensive understanding of the financial aspects associated with nursing home care in Glendora, California.

Does Medicaid or Medicare pay for nursing homes in Glendora, California?

Medicaid and Medicare provide different types of coverage for nursing home care in Glendora, California, and understanding their distinctions is crucial. Medicare may cover short-term stays in a skilled nursing facility if certain conditions are met, such as a prior hospital stay of at least three days and the need for skilled nursing or rehabilitation services. This coverage is typically limited to up to 100 days per benefit period, with the first 20 days fully covered and co-payments required for days 21 through 100. Medicaid, on the other hand, is designed for long-term care and can cover the full cost of nursing home care for eligible individuals with low income and assets. Medicaid eligibility requires meeting specific financial and medical criteria, and the program may pay for both personal and medical care services in a nursing home. It is essential to contact a Medicaid specialist for guidance on eligibility and application processes.

What factors should be considered when choosing a nursing home in Glendora, California?

When choosing a nursing home in Glendora, California, several critical factors should be evaluated to ensure the best possible care and living conditions. First, consider the facility's reputation and reviews from residents and their families, which can provide insight into the quality of care and overall satisfaction. Visit the nursing home to inspect the cleanliness, safety features, and general atmosphere. Check for the availability of specialized care services that may be needed, such as memory care for dementia patients. Assess the qualifications and experience of the staff, including nurses and caregivers, and verify their training and certification. Additionally, evaluate the types of amenities and activities offered, as these can significantly impact the residents' quality of life. Ensure that the facility complies with state regulations and has up-to-date licensing and accreditation. Finally, review the cost and payment options, including whether the facility accepts Medicare or Medicaid, to ensure it aligns with your financial situation.

What types of financial assistance are available for nursing home care in Glendora, California?

In Glendora, California, several types of financial assistance may be available to help cover the cost of nursing home care. Medicare may provide limited coverage for nursing home care if certain conditions are met, such as a hospital stay of at least three days before admission and the need for skilled nursing care. Medicaid, a joint federal and state program, offers more extensive coverage for long-term nursing home care for eligible individuals with low income and assets. To qualify for Medicaid, you must meet specific financial criteria and may need to spend down assets or income to meet eligibility requirements. Additionally, there may be veterans' benefits for those who have served in the military, which can help with nursing home costs. Some long-term care insurance policies may also cover nursing home expenses, depending on the terms of the policy. It's advisable to consult with a financial advisor or elder law attorney to explore all available options and determine the best approach for your situation.

How do nursing homes in GLENDORA handle specialized care needs such as dementia or mobility issues?

Nursing homes in GLENDORA can address specialized care needs such as dementia or mobility issues by offering tailored programs and services designed to meet the unique requirements of these conditions. For residents with dementia, some facilities provide specialized memory care units or programs that focus on creating a secure environment, offering structured routines, and utilizing therapeutic activities that enhance cognitive function and quality of life. Staff members in these units often receive additional training in dementia care techniques to manage behavioral symptoms and support residents effectively. For mobility issues, nursing homes may offer physical therapy services to help improve or maintain mobility. The facility should be equipped with assistive devices like wheelchairs, walkers, and grab bars, and staff should be trained in proper techniques for transferring and assisting residents with mobility challenges. Additionally, facilities may implement safety measures to prevent falls and accidents, such as clear pathways and adaptive equipment. It's important to discuss these specific needs with the nursing home during your visit to ensure they have the appropriate resources and expertise to provide the necessary care.
